Transaction 81e8b63e13d301b509493581cebbe531f1172a0c7bc0807908a29c2c5899bc15

1 Input
2 Outputs
  • 81e8b63e13d301b509493581cebbe531f1172a0c7bc0807908a29c2c5899bc15:0
  • value  340500
    address  3JpZBnxBMSmMFTPKxtR9VvCTsLLkHhZf9H
  • 81e8b63e13d301b509493581cebbe531f1172a0c7bc0807908a29c2c5899bc15:1
  • value  99654635
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v